Defense Attorneys
Legal professionals who represent and defend the rights of individuals accused of crimes in court.
Not Guilty by Reason of Insanity
A legal defense where a defendant claims they were unable to understand the nature of their crime or differentiate right from wrong due to a mental disorder at the time of the offense.
